Origin, Meaning And History of Zain
Zain is derived from the masculine Arabic name Zayn. It can be translated to mean ‘beauty,’ ‘excellent,’ ‘adornment,’ or ‘grace.’ Some other meanings of the name in Arabic are ‘servant of God’ and ‘king.’
Through the course of history, the name has also been anglicized to the name Zane and possesses the same meaning as it does in Arabic. Another interpretation of the name is that it is derived from and is the transcription of the seventh letter of the Hebrew alphabet. This can also refer to other Semitic languages, such as Aramaic and Phoenician. It is believed that the Greeks took this letter from the Phoenicians to form their letter Zeta, represented by the letter ‘Z.’
According to this interpretation, the name Zain would mean seventh in Hebrew. It is also believed to be an altered spelling of the popularly used surname Zane. Zain is predominantly used as a masculine name but can occasionally be adopted by females. It is most popular among those that follow the religion of Islam. The name is also the title of Psalm 119:49 in the New American Standard Version. The passage reads, ‘Remember the word to Your servant, In which You have made me hope.’
The name Zain can be pronounced; ‘ZIEN.’ Zain is a masculine name, and its feminine versions are Zaina and Zayna. It also has a few spelling variations, including Zayn, Zane, Zayne, Zaen, Zein, Zaene, Zeine, and Zeyne. In addition, Zain can have pet names, such as Zee, Zeezee, Zen, Zay, Zayzay, Zaynu, and Zaynie.

Zain On The Popularity Chart
According to the US Social Security Administration chart, the popularity of the name Zain has increased tremendously since the 1980s. However, the name’s ranking has seen a decline.
Popularity Over Time
The popularity of the name Zain steadily rose and was the highest in 2019 with over 524 babies per million getting the name.
